On the SolrCloud wiki page (https://wiki.apache.org/solr/SolrCloud), I found this statement:
The Grouping feature only works if groups are in the same shard. You must use the custom sharding feature to use the Grouping feature. However, the Distributed Search page (https://wiki.apache.org/solr/DistributedSearch) implies that grouping largely works, and the actual grouping page (or rather Field Collapsing: http://wiki.apache.org/solr/FieldCollapsing) goes into much more detail, outlining limitations on specific features. Am I right in assuming that the statement on the SolrCloud page is out of date? I'm happy to replace it with some text that links to https://wiki.apache.org/solr/DistributedSearch#Distributed_Searching_Lim itations if that makes more sense? Similarly, on the Distributed Search page, we find: Doesn't support MoreLikeThis -- (see https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SOLR-788) Looking at the issue, it seems this has been (largely?) resolved since Solr 4.1 and 5.0.
